#f5de04 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f5de04 is composed of 96.1% red, 87.1%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.4%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 54.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 48.8%. #f5de04 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#ebbd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#f5de04 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f5de04 has RGB values of R:245, G:222,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.98,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16113156.

Shades and Tints of #f5de04

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0c00 is the darkest color, while #fffef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f5de04

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828177 is the less saturated color, while #f5de04 is the most saturated one.
